This feature takes us behind the scenes with Sven Martin, one of the most recognised downhill dirt shooters at the world’s premiere mountain bike festival, Crankworx. This week-long biking event in Whistler BC, attracts the world’s top riders from every event, including downhill, cross-country and slopestyle, just to name a few. With over 25,000 spectators, it’s become the largest mountain bike festival ever.

The high speed action makes it extremely challenging to capture through photography and video. Those who are aren’t prepped and ready will miss the shot. The combination of the event’s high-paced action, and difficult to access locations only adds to the intensity. Needless to say, Sven has mastered this process, making it look easy.
